// REINDEX_BATCH_CAP limits docs per shard pass in the Tallowfield
// nightly search reindex. Raising it starves the ingest queue;
// lowering it overruns the maintenance window. 5000 is the tested
// sweet spot. Change only with a soak run. Verified against the
// build noted below.

session token of bawif-hahog = htk6_ac5981

All Drossel-portfolio leases come up for renewal between May and August. Target: 12% reduction in effective rent, achieved via longer terms and deferred fit-out allowances. Do not signal renewal intent to landlords before central negotiates framework terms. Branches in Ketterby and Vass are priority; both have viable relocation alternatives we can use as leverage. Report landlord contact attempts to regional ops weekly. Budget assumes two branch relocations worst case. The confidential strategic context is set out below.

internal memo for yahaf-hawif: The finance team signed off on a budget of $59.9 million for Project Rusax.

**Action Item 4:** During the outage, the Whisperhall audio-guide app kept retrying tour downloads against the dead CDN origin with no backoff, which amplified load once service recovered. Add exponential backoff with jitter to the download client and cap retries at five per tour. Owner: mobile team, due next sprint. Retry configuration details and the rollout checklist are documented on the internal page.

operations page: https://jenkins.zemvarcloud.local/job/merge_requests/repo/build/73930b4b30f0a8ed

Step 3: Switch over the Pondhopper queue-depth autoscaler. Once you flip the feature flag, workers scale on backlog depth instead of CPU, so don't panic if pod counts jump during busy mornings — that's the point. If customers report stuck jobs, check the backlog gauge first. The autoscaler reads queue metrics from the stats database, which it reaches using the connection string that follows.

replica DSN, tawef-hahap: mysql://eliix_svc:FiIC0jz@db-394a.lumiclabs.internal:5432/holius